    Really excellent coffee. A bit of the bite of Jamaican Blue mellowed slightly by the Americans. Balanced medium roast with pleasant aroma and satisfying brewed flavor and body. French press preparation recommended.

    These beans have no aroma before grinding, and almost none after. And by the way, there are supposed to be 12 oz of beans in each can. I’ve weighed the contents of the 3 cans I got, and all are at least 1 oz below that.
